DIY Solar Power for Bitcoin Mining: A Sustainable Approach to Crypto Mining

In recent years, Bitcoin mining has gained immense popularity, attracting both enthusiasts and investors. However, the process of mining cryptocurrencies requires a significant amount of energy, leading to high electricity bills and environmental concerns. To address these issues, many individuals are turning to DIY solar power for Bitcoin mining. This article explores the benefits and steps involved in setting up a DIY solar power system for Bitcoin mining.
The Importance of DIY Solar Power for Bitcoin Mining
Bitcoin mining is an energy-intensive process that involves solving complex mathematical puzzles to validate transactions and secure the network. As the difficulty level of mining increases, so does the energy consumption. Traditional electricity sources, such as coal or natural gas, contribute to greenhouse gas emissions and environmental degradation. By utilizing DIY solar power for Bitcoin mining, individuals can reduce their carbon footprint and lower their electricity costs.
Benefits of DIY Solar Power for Bitcoin Mining
1. Cost Savings: One of the primary advantages of using DIY solar power for Bitcoin mining is the potential for significant cost savings. By generating your own electricity, you can reduce or eliminate your electricity bills, resulting in substantial savings over time.
2. Environmental Sustainability: Solar power is a renewable energy source that produces no greenhouse gas emissions during operation. By harnessing solar energy for Bitcoin mining, you contribute to a greener and more sustainable future.
3. Energy Independence: DIY solar power for Bitcoin mining allows you to become energy-independent. By generating your own electricity, you are less reliant on traditional energy providers, giving you greater control over your energy consumption and costs.
Steps to Set Up DIY Solar Power for Bitcoin Mining
1. Assess Your Energy Needs: Before setting up a DIY solar power system for Bitcoin mining, it is crucial to assess your energy needs. Determine the amount of electricity required to power your mining equipment and calculate the size of the solar system needed to meet those demands.
2. Choose the Right Solar Panels: Select high-quality solar panels that can generate enough electricity to meet your mining needs. Consider factors such as efficiency, warranty, and cost when making your choice.
3. Install the Solar Panels: Once you have purchased the solar panels, it's time to install them. Ensure that the panels are positioned to receive maximum sunlight throughout the day. You may need to hire a professional installer or follow a detailed installation guide to ensure proper setup.
4. Connect the Solar Panels to an Inverter: An inverter is necessary to convert the DC electricity generated by the solar panels into AC electricity, which can be used to power your Bitcoin mining equipment.
5. Set Up a Battery Bank (Optional): If you want to store excess electricity for use during cloudy days or at night, consider setting up a battery bank. This will provide a backup power source and ensure continuous operation of your mining equipment.
6. Connect the Mining Rig: Finally, connect your Bitcoin mining rig to the inverter and start mining. Monitor the system's performance and make adjustments as needed to optimize energy consumption and efficiency.
Conclusion
DIY solar power for Bitcoin mining offers a sustainable and cost-effective solution to the energy demands of mining cryptocurrencies. By harnessing renewable energy sources, individuals can reduce their carbon footprint, save money, and contribute to a greener future. With careful planning and execution, setting up a DIY solar power system for Bitcoin mining can be a rewarding and environmentally friendly endeavor.
